Become A Dental Assistant

A dental assistant is a dental professional that assists a dentist with a variety of patient care, including clinical, office, and laboratory duties. Most dental assistants work in dentists offices, while some hold positions in government positions or physicians offices. Dental assisting for many people, provides the training and experience to gain a higher skilled and higher paying job.

Dental Assistant Training Requirements To Obtain A Dental Assistant Certification

Dental Assistant training programs must also follow the training requirements and guidelines set forth by the ADA and the Commission on Dental Accreditation. A typical dental assisting training course involves education in, radiology, anatomy, physiology, as well as clinical and administrative procedures that are required by a dental assistant. These skills help to make a dental assistant desirable not only for dentist’s offices, but also dental supply manufacturers, insurance companies, and hospital dental departments. Courses may also include preparation for practical and written exams that may be taken in order to become a registered dental assistant.

Certification standards vary according to the requirements of individual states. If required by the state, dental assistants must pass the exam administered by the Dental Assisting National Board (DANB). Graduates from an approved dental assisting program are eligible for examination as well as those with two to four years of dental assisting experience. Though not required for employment in most states, it is highly recommended or dental assistants to have a Registered Dental Assistant (RDA) status, which involves further examination.

Dental Assistant Schools and Degree Programs

Dental assisting is a fast growing profession that offers great hours and benefits. Attending a school which offers training for dental assisting in a certificate or diploma program allows you to enter the workforce quickly. There are currently 265 American Dental Association (ADA) approved dental assisting training programs offered in dental schools and colleges throughout the United States.

Dental Assistant Prerequisites

There are 265 approved dental assisting programs that follow the guidelines of the ADA and Commission on Dental Accreditation. These organizations determine that those wishing to enter a dental assisting program are required to have a high school diploma or equivalent. Various schools and colleges offer flexible course schedules that range from day, night and weekend classes and training sessions.

Dental Assistant Continuing Education

In order renew certification, dental assistants must earn credits in continued education. Continued education courses are also important for employment advancement opportunities.
